What are CPIPSM Recorded Webinars?

CPIPSM Recorded Webinars are a group of Recorded Webinarswas developed to help individuals in preparation for the Certified Pharmaceutical Industry ProfessionalSM (CPIPSM) examination..

The Certified Pharmaceutical Industry ProfessionalSM (CPIPSM) credential recognizes “change agents” as the necessary ingredient to foster industry innovation and enhance drug product quality. The credential establishes a global competency standard for industry professionals, and candidates are assessed through demonstrated education, experience, and a rigorous examination. Completion of any of these seminars does not guarantee successful completion of the CPIP certification exam, and these seminars do not include every subject to the depth of what will be covered on the CPIP exam.
